- Title
PancPRO: risk assessment for individuals with a family history of pancreatic cancer.
- Authors
Wang, Wenyi; Chen, Sining; Brune, Kieran A; Hruban, Ralph H; Parmigiani, Giovanni; Klein, Alison P
- Abstract
The rapid fatality of pancreatic cancer is, in large part, the result of an advanced stage of diagnosis for the majority of patients. Identification of individuals at high risk of developing pancreatic cancer is a first step towards the early detection of this disease. Individuals who may harbor a major pancreatic cancer susceptibility gene are one such high-risk group. The goal of this study was to develop and validate PancPRO, a Mendelian model for pancreatic cancer risk prediction in individuals with familial pancreatic cancer, to identify high-risk individuals.
